Army foils infiltration bid, 1 Jawan dies, 2 terrorists killed

In less than 24 hours after foiling infiltration bid and killing insurgents, Indian army killed three militants who tried to trespass the Line of Control(LoC) in Naugam sector in north Kashmir’s Kupwara district on Thursday.

On Wednesday, three heavily-armed militants were killed along LoC after gun fight.
On May 26, the Army killed two Pakistani Border Action Team(BAT) members during their attempt to pass through  LoC into Uri sector where BAT frequently ambushes patrol teams.

Next day six more militants were killed in infiltration bid in the same region.

Melting snow has opened up passages infiltrators and Pak army backed insurgency waits for to enter along LoC.
